Ignacio Rivera is an American BDSM educator, author, lecturer, and activist whose work has significantly expanded contemporary discussions of consent, power exchange, identity, and cultural diversity within kink communities. Drawing upon decades of experience as an educator and community organiser, Rivera has developed an interdisciplinary approach that combines BDSM education with trauma awareness, communication, intersectionality, disability advocacy, and queer studies. Rivera's teaching consistently encourages participants to examine not only technique and negotiation but also the broader social, cultural, and psychological contexts in which consensual power exchange takes place. Their work has helped broaden BDSM education by incorporating perspectives that were historically underrepresented within mainstream Leather and kink literature. Beyond books and essays, Rivera has taught internationally through workshops, conferences, universities, and community organisations, becoming one of the leading voices advocating inclusive, consent-centred, and culturally informed BDSM education.

Legacy & Influence
Ignacio Rivera is recognised as one of the leading voices in contemporary inclusive BDSM education. By integrating consent, communication, trauma awareness, disability advocacy, intersectionality, and cultural diversity into discussions of power exchange, Rivera helped broaden the scope of BDSM education beyond technical practice alone. Their work has influenced educators, conference organisers, and community leaders seeking to build more accessible, reflective, and inclusive learning environments.
